Learning Objectives
4 objectives- Understand the fundamental principles and history of automotive engineering technology.
- Analyze key vehicle systems including powertrain, dynamics, electrical/electronic, and safety.
- Explore automotive materials, manufacturing processes, and sustainable technologies.
- Develop skills in automotive maintenance, diagnostics, and design considerations.
Content Outline
PreviewUnit 3646: Automotive Engineering Technology
1. Introduction to Automotive Engineering Technology
- Overview of automotive engineering technology
- Historical development of automotive engineering
- Key concepts and terminology
- Importance of automotive engineering in the industry
2. Automotive Powertrain Systems
- Components of powertrain systems
- Internal combustion engines (ICE)
- Transmissions: manual, automatic, CVT, dual-clutch
- Drivelines and differentials
- Power transfer and torque conversion
- Hybrid and electric powertrain basics
3. Vehicle Dynamics and Control
- Vehicle motion fundamentals
- Suspension systems
- Types of suspension (independent, dependent)
- Springs, dampers, anti-roll bars
- Steering mechanisms
- Rack and pinion, power steering
- Braking systems
- Disc and drum brakes
- Anti-lock braking systems (ABS)
- Electronic stability control and traction control systems
4. Automotive Materials and Manufacturing Processes
- Common automotive materials
- Metals: steel, aluminum, magnesium
- Polymers and plastics
- Composite materials
- Material properties relevant to automotive use
- Manufacturing processes
- Casting, forging, stamping
- Welding and joining techniques
- Assembly line and automation
5. Automotive Electrical and Electronic Systems
- Fundamentals of vehicle electrical systems
- Sensors and actuators
- Wiring harnesses and circuit design
- Batteries and charging systems
- Introduction to vehicle communication networks (CAN, LIN)
- Advanced technologies
- Hybrid and electric vehicle electronics
- Control units and embedded systems
6. Vehicle Safety and Crashworthiness
- Principles of vehicle safety engineering
- Passive safety systems
- Seat belts, airbags, crumple zones
- Active safety systems
- Electronic stability control, collision avoidance
- Crashworthiness and energy absorption
- Crash testing procedures and standards
- Regulatory frameworks and safety standards
7. Automotive Design and Styling
- Role of design in automotive engineering
- Aerodynamics and drag reduction
- Aesthetic considerations and ergonomics
- Design process and tools
- Integration of form and function
8. Sustainable Automotive Technologies
- Environmental impact of automobiles
- Alternative fuels
- Biofuels, hydrogen
- Electric vehicles and battery technology
- Fuel cell vehicles
- Lightweight materials and design for sustainability
- Eco-friendly manufacturing processes
9. Automotive Maintenance and Diagnostics
- Routine maintenance procedures
- Diagnostic techniques and troubleshooting
- Diagnostic tools and equipment
- Engine performance and emission testing
- Preventive maintenance and repair strategies
